This space carries a fascinating history—it was once the workshop of Shatzie Crouch, a pioneering woman and wife of the late Hondo Crouch of famed Luckenbach. When she wasn't spending time with Waylon, Willie, and the boys, Shatzie used this building to restore vintage cars and furniture. Imagine the surprise of locals seeing her roll out from under a 1929 Ford Model A, wrench in hand and a grease smudge on her cheek! The décor celebrates her legacy, reflecting her time tinkering and restoring. Shatzie's contributions were honored with the Texas Star Award for Conservation Work and the Pioneer Award by the Gillespie County Historical Society.
